Exhibition-goers walk past Nam June Paik's Electronic Superhighway (second photo). The American Art Museum will be highlighting the work of video art pioneer Paik with a show of his work in December 2012.

While GameFest is taking place in both our Kogod Courtyard and McEvoy Auditorium, people are also taking in The Art of Video Games exhibition. Right now the line to get in stretches around the entire third floor of the building. The great thing about waiting in this line is you get to see amazing art as you move forward.

Don't be dissuaded from seeing the show by the looks of this opening weekend crowd. There's plenty of time. You've got until the end of September to see it.
